7. HIKING PATROL SOFT SHELL TROUSER
Always find it difficult to purchase trousers over the colder months and when I came across these by Hiking Patrol, there was no doubt in my mind and I purchased them as soon as I tried them on in-store. Why? Well, the trousers are made out of a water-repellent material with a soft brushed inner which provides additional comfort and most importantly warmth. I’m a big fan of the balance of contemporary style and functionality making them the perfect trousers this month.

5. SAN SAN GEAR X ADVANCED RESEARCH
The EAST MEET EAST collection draws inspiration from the shared history of division experienced by South Korea and East Germany, reimagining the Rain Camouflage ‘Strichtarn’ with the Advanced Research blue brand colour throughout. I have been really looking forward to seeing the release since seeing the first pictures and the collaboration has been perfectly executed.
This collection was revealed earlier in the year at Paris Fashion Week and finally released via The Spaces Inbetween store and features a technical rain jacket with an asymmetrical zipper running across the body, detachable lined full-face covering ear flap cap, multi-pocket waterproof pants a utilitarian vest bag.
